What's The Definition Of Ethelbert?

Ethelbert in American English
noun: a male given name: from Old English words meaning “ noble” and “ bright”

Ethelbert in American English 1
a masculine name

Ethelbert in American English 2
a. d. 552?-616; king of Kent (560-616)

Ethelbert in British English
noun: Saint. ?552–616 ad, king of Kent (560–616): converted to Christianity by St Augustine; issued the earliest known code of English laws. Feast day: Feb 24 or 25
